In recent years, the construction industry has faced increasing pressures to reduce its environmental impact. Concrete, as a core material, is a significant contributor to CO2 emissions, accounting for about 8% of global emissions. This statistic underscores the need for change. One of the standout innovations from All Mighty Concrete LLC is their use of alternative materials in concrete production. These include incorporating recycled industrial by-products like fly ash and slag, which significantly reduce the need for traditional cement. The environmental benefit here is twofold: it reduces waste going to landfill and lowers the carbon emissions associated with cement manufacturing. Moreover, All Mighty Concrete LLC is committed to innovation in concrete curing techniques. Traditional methods require large amounts of water and energy. However, by employing advanced curing methods such as carbonation curing, energy consumption is significantly reduced. This technique not only lowers emissions but also enhances the durability and strength of the concrete.
